Frequently Asked Questions about Westgate
What type of rentals are currently available in Westgate?
There are currently 222 Apartments for Rent in Westgate, TX with pricing that ranges from $715 to $18,509. There are also 244 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Westgate ranging from $650 to $10,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Westgate?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Westgate ranges from $650 to $10,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,125.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Westgate?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Westgate range from $1,395 to $9,151,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,649 to $7,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$650 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$3,500.
